Kerstin Dreesen

Customer Operations Specialist at TestingTime

Kerstin Dreesen has a diverse work experience spanning various roles and sectors. Kerstin is currently working as a Customer Operations Specialist at TestingTime, where they support clients in finding suitable candidates for market research projects and ensures product quality. Kerstin also owns their own business, sugarprintsDE, since 2021. Prior to that, they co-owned Barjiji & Dreesen GbR and vertical publishing UG. Kerstin has also worked as a Content Creator at Delticom AG, where they focused on specific websites related to tire sales, and as a Company Owner at Sitzsack Onlineshop. Additionally, they served as a Business Development Manager at Lioncast Gaming and Online Marketing Manager at Schmellenkamp Communications. Kerstin started their career as a Content Creator at GIATA GmbH and later worked as a Sales and Marketing Specialist at Axel Springer SE. Overall, Kerstin Dreesen has gained extensive experience in customer support, content creation, business development, and marketing throughout their career.

Kerstin Dreesen has a diverse educational background. From 1996 to 1999, they attended Technische Universität Dresden, where they studied Politikwissenschaft, Wirtschaftswissenschaft, and Anglistik. Following this, they pursued their studies at the University of Warwick - Warwick Business School from 1999 to 2000, focusing on Politics and International Studies. Later, from 2003 to 2007, Kerstin Dreesen enrolled at RheinMain University of Applied Sciences, where they obtained their Diplom degree in Medienwirtschaft.

TestingTime

TestingTime’s customers are in the UX and market research industry and both markets are in need of participants for usability tests, interviews, focus groups, diary studies and surveys. TestingTime provides a pool of more than 350,000 test users from which customers order their desired target users for qualitative and quantitative user researchonline. Test users are acquired through online campaigns and referral mechanisms and a smart rating system and predictive machine learning algorithms ensure high quality test users with a low no-show rate. The company is currently used by large corporations like UBS, Zalando, Microsoft, Accenture and many more.
